What is a key benefit of conducting thorough market research?

Conducting thorough market research provides insights into consumer behavior, which is essential for effective decision-making in marketing strategies. By understanding what consumers want, need, and how they perceive products or services, businesses can tailor their offerings to meet those demands more precisely. This knowledge allows companies to identify trends, consumer preferences, and pain points, leading to more informed choices about product development, pricing, and promotional strategies.

When companies leverage this information, they enhance their chances of success in the marketplace, as they are basing decisions on data-driven insights rather than assumptions. This approach not only helps in creating products that resonate with the target audience but also optimizes marketing efforts, increasing the likelihood of achieving better results in sales and customer satisfaction.

In contrast, limiting the number of products launched annually, assuring immediate sales outcomes, or guaranteeing market dominance do not inherently derive from market research. Each of those options suggests outcomes that are not reliably produced solely through the research process. Instead, effective market research equips businesses with the knowledge needed to navigate these aspects with greater confidence and precision.
